NiO and different concentrations of Ce/Mg-doped NiO nanoparticles were synthesized by a simple microwave method, with urea as a precursor material. The structural, optical, magnetic properties, as well as antibacterial efficiency, were investigated.
The NiO and different concentrations of Ce/Mg-doped NiO were prepared by simple microwave method. For this synthesis, urea is added as a precursor material. The optical, magnetic, and antibacterial properties of the synthesized nanoparticles were investigated. The powdered XRD diffraction pattern gives the structural analysis and also the study revealed that the particles were multi polycrystalline nature. The HRTEM images show that the nanoparticles were homogeneous spherical particles. The UV-visible spectrum shows that while increasing the cerium doping concentration, the band gap energy also increases. The bacterial efficiency of the synthesized samples was analyzed by using Gram-positive and Gram-negative bacteria.
